1H-Indole-5-ethanamine

Description:
1H-Indole-5-ethanamine, also known as 5-ethanaminomethylindole, is an organic compound characterized by its indole structure, which consists of a fused benzene and pyrrole ring. This compound features an ethylamine side chain at the 5-position of the indole ring, contributing to its unique chemical properties. It is typically a colorless to pale yellow solid or liquid, depending on its purity and form. The presence of the amine group makes it a basic compound, capable of forming salts with acids. 1H-Indole-5-ethanamine is of interest in various fields, including medicinal chemistry, due to its potential biological activity and role as a building block in the synthesis of more complex molecules. Its reactivity can be influenced by the indole moiety, which can participate in various chemical reactions, such as electrophilic substitutions. Additionally, this compound may exhibit properties relevant to neurotransmitter activity, making it a subject of study in neuropharmacology. Safety and handling precautions should be observed, as with any chemical substance, due to potential toxicity and reactivity.
